Driver claims damages as result of being hit by truck

BECKLEY — A motorist is suing truck driver Willie Earl Hunt and truck owner Crane Transport Inc., alleging that insufficient measures were taken to prevent injuries.

Danny Lockhart Jr. filed a complaint on July 19 in Raleigh Circuit Court against the defendants, alleging that Hunt negligently operated the tractor-trailer owned by Crane Transport.

According to the complaint, the plaintiff alleges that on July 5, 2015, his car was rear-ended by the truck driven by Hunt. As a direct and proximate result, the suit says, the plaintiff sustain serious compensable injuries, both physical and emotional. He was caused to suffer medical expenses, pain and suffering, annoyance, inconvenience and lost wages, the suit alleges. The plaintiff holds the defendants responsible for Hunt's alleged failure to keep a proper lookout and ,maintain control of the truck.

The plaintiff requests a trial by jury and seeks compensation for all damages to which to which he is legally entitled and such other relief as the court deems just and proper. He is represented by David A. Kirkpatrick of Kirkpatrick Law Office in Beckley.

Raleigh Circuit Court Case number 16-C-489
